Chapter reorganization. This edition now groups the "big picture" chapters together at the beginning, with Chapter One discussing the workplace environment and the nature of communication problems; Chapter Two stressing the importance of reader-centred, ethical communication; and Chapter Three situating this content in the context of communicating across different countries' cultures and across cultures within Canada. The coverage of document design and visual rhetoric are still a distinctive strength of this resource, but the two chapters on these topics have been streamlined and combined into one chapter, and the section on report formatting has been moved to the chapter on creating the right type of report.
Problem Solver to the Rescue exercise. This new exercise has been added to the end of each chapter. Each exercise features a flawed solution to a communication scenario and invites students to use the problem-solving approach and the advice in the chapter to critique and rewrite the communication.
Expanded focus on problem-solving. In the second Canadian edition, the focus on problem-solving has been more thoroughly integrated throughout the book.
Updated Research and Examples. The contents of every chapter in the second Canadian edition, including Annotated Examples and boxed features, have been updated for currency and usefulness.
Current Topics. To ensure the content is relevant for learners, the second Canadian edition covers current topics, including the impacts of the coronavirus pandemic and social-justice issues on business communication.
Expanded content in Reference Chapter A. This chapter now includes instruction on sentence-building before discussing correctness. Students will be better able to see the logic behind the rules for punctuation and grammar presented in this chapter, understand the stylistic advice given in Chapter Six ("Crafting Effective Sentences and Paragraphs"), and tackle the Power Charge Your Professionalism activities.
